Big game Combo:
12,883 tags availabe
309 with 3pp (roughly 300 has been the average the last 3 years)

12600 available for 2pp
10585 didn't draw with 1pp last year so now have 2pp.

Outfitters say they take about 25-30% of licenses annually say its 20% of the 12600 is 2520 of the applicants will have 2pp to start just by welfare.

So you have 10585 DIY people plus the 2520 outfitter welfare tags is 13105 for the 12600 at 2pp. Making your odds 96% without even figuring in the people who just bought a point last year, with plans of applying with 2pp this year.

Looking at the past 3 years there's roughly 1000 people that are buying a pt and not applying with 1 and waiting for 2pp.

So if you add the 1000 average growth you have 14000 people applying for 12600 tags odds of 90%. So my 75-80% might have been low probably closer to 90% odds with 2pp.

However, I feel the real kick in the shorts is you will almost be 100% to lose your PP when you pull a leftover tag.
